How to download and setup Technical-Markdown
Open terminal and run command
git clone https://github.com/gabyx/Technical-Markdown.git
git clone is used to create a copy or clone of Technical-Markdown repositories.
You pass git clone a repository URL. it supports a few different network protocols and corresponding URL formats.
Also you may download zip file with Technical-Markdown https://github.com/gabyx/Technical-Markdown/archive/master.zip
Or simply clone Technical-Markdown with SSH
[email protected]:gabyx/Technical-Markdown.git
